Asthma Athletics Swim Programs have taken place throughout Phoenix and surrounding cities since August 2002. Swim partners have included the YMCA, Banner Childrens Hospital and Swim Kids USA. Both the children and parents are encouraged to participate. The program lasts for 1 month. Each visit begins with a check in, where children learn to use peak flow meters.
An Asthma Lesson follows, which lasts 30-45 minutes. during this lesson children and parents learn an aspect of asthma care. Various asthma topics are addressed and later enforced with games. The swim lessons are lead by qualified swim instructors. As the children are participating in the swim lesson, parents meet with volunteer health care providers who offer asthma education.
In order to get the most out of the program, the parents and child should make sure they are able to attend all 4 sessions of the program. These programs will be held throughout the year.
